自动化辅助开发是什么

自动化辅助开发,简称AAD(Automated Assistant Development),是一种利用自动化工具和技术来辅助软件开发过程的方法。🔧👨‍💻 在这个快速发展的数字化时代,软件开发的需求日益增长,而传统的人工开发模式已无法满足日益复杂的项目需求,AAD应运而生,旨在提高开发效率,降低成本,提升软件质量。

AAD的核心思想是通过自动化工具来辅助开发者完成一些重复性、低效的工作,使开发者能够将更多精力投入到更具创造性和技术挑战性的任务中。🤖👩‍💻 下面,我们来详细了解AAD的几个关键方面:

  1. 代码生成:AAD工具可以根据设计文档或需求规格自动生成代码,减少人工编写代码的时间,提高代码质量。🔍💻

  2. 测试自动化:通过自动化测试工具,可以快速执行大量测试用例,及时发现和修复缺陷,保证软件质量。🔍🔧

  3. 持续集成与持续部署(CI/CD):AAD工具可以帮助实现自动化构建、测试和部署,提高开发流程的自动化程度,缩短产品上市时间。🚀🔧

  4. 代码审查:自动化工具可以对代码进行审查,检查潜在的安全隐患、性能问题等,确保代码质量。🔍🔐

  5. 性能优化:通过分析工具,AAD可以帮助开发者发现和优化软件性能瓶颈,提升用户体验。🚀🔧

AAD的实施不仅提高了开发效率,还带来了以下好处:

  • 降低成本:自动化工具可以减少人力成本,提高资源利用率。💰🔧
  • 提高质量:自动化测试和审查可以保证软件质量,降低缺陷率。🔍🔐
  • 缩短周期:自动化流程可以缩短开发周期,加快产品上市速度。🚀🔧
  • 增强协作:AAD工具可以促进团队成员之间的协作,提高团队整体效率。👨‍💻👩‍💻

自动化辅助开发是当前软件开发领域的一个重要趋势,随着技术的不断发展,AAD将会在软件开发中发挥越来越重要的作用。🚀🔧👨‍💻👩‍💻

上一篇:

下一篇:

相关文章

联系我们

在线咨询:点击这里给我发消息

邮件:819640@qq.com

地址:还未填写您的联系地址

QR code